Looking for a stroller bassinet that is explicitly approved for overnight sleep in the US? This shortlist focuses on models where the manufacturer clearly states that the bassinet can be used for overnight sleep, often with a matching stand or a specific setup.

This is not a list of ordinary strollers where a baby might happen to nap during a walk. We only highlight models with clear overnight-sleep approval so you can compare the right bassinet setups faster.

    Bugaboo Fox 5 Renew

    Best: All-terrain

    Bugaboo Fox 5 Renew is the premium all-terrain stroller fit for families who want one polished main stroller with a real bassinet setup and calmer ride quality on rougher pavements. For overnight sleep, only use the bassinet setup exactly as Bugaboo currently approves it; the stroller seat itself is not an overnight-sleep claim.

    Pros

    • Large all-terrain wheels, suspension, and a proper bassinet setup give it a stronger main-stroller case than many compact premium options.

    Cons

    • The price and size only make sense if you will use the ride quality, bassinet stage, and outdoor confidence often.
